Digest scheduling jobs on the Lanternfish CI pool started double-firing after we moved the batch email cron into the shared runner group. Root cause: two runners both claimed the schedule because the lock table wasn't migrated with the rest of the Quillbury schema. Fix is in the scheduler shim — it now acquires a lease before enqueueing. If you see duplicate digests again, confirm the workers are all running the lease-aware build listed below.

trace token, kawip-fafog: htk14_26e64c4d35154e

## TKT-4417: Signature check fails on cold start

Cold-started handlers on the Breva platform fail signature verification for the first invocation, then succeed. Suspect the trust bundle isn't mounted before the verifier runs. New folks: reproduce by scaling `quote-handler` to zero and invoking once. To test locally, verify the artifact against the deploy key below.

rollout seal: bky4_x7Gc

Subject: SDK parity gaps — Kestrelline JS vs. Swift

Team,

The Swift SDK still lacks batch upload and retry hooks present in JS since v3.2. Parity matrix is on the Moorfen wiki; please keep it current as fixes land. Verify each gap against the staging gateway before closing. Staging calls authenticate with the token below.

session JWT of yawep-yawep = eyJhbGciOiJIUzI1NiIsInR5cCI6IkpXVCJ9.eyJzdWIiOiI3pWF3_In0.aXYsHiog

// Max concurrent transcode jobs per node on the Renderhawk farm.
// Set to 6. Higher values starve the audio muxing stage and jobs
// silently stall at 99%. Yes, the hardware can technically do 8;
// no, don't raise it without load-testing the mux queue first.
// If you're debugging a stuck job, first confirm the node is on
// the current farm build. That build's token is recorded below.

pipeline stamp: htk31_f769b577b3028a4e9958e5bb8d1259a